The correct route through which pulse-making impulse travels in the heart is

A

SA node `rightarrow` Purkinje fibres `rightarrow` Bundle of His `rightarrow` AV node

B

SA node `rightarrow` AV node `rightarrow` Bundle of His `rightarrow` Purkinje fibres

C

SA node `rightarrow` AV node `rightarrow` Purkinje fibres `rightarrow` Bundle of His

D

SA node `rightarrow` Bundle of His `rightarrow` AV node `rightarrow` Purkinje fibres
